Ken Clarke urges flexibility on customs union with EU

  • 5 years ago
Veteran Tory MP Ken Clarke says he welcomes the PM's acknowledgement of the need to compromise, as well as her comments that she will not compromise on a permanently open border on the island of Ireland. Mr Clarke suggests reaching out to Remainers, at least by relaxing her "normal rejection" of a customs union and regulatory alignment.
